I tried to sign up for DPI Energy service. Pre-pay was explained and I was asked for a $50 deposit. I paid it via credit card on the phone. I was next sent to "Verification" where I was told I do not qualify for their service because I answered "Yes" to being a "critical care" customer (reliant on electric-powered medical equipment). I asked for my $50 back. I was repeatedly put on hold for 10-20 minutes at a time before being disconnected or picked back up by the same person acting like they hadn't just spoken with me before putting me on hold. I am told only that I can have my refund in 10-14 business days (two weeks and a day to three weeks from now), that they have no control over it because the main office does it, the main office doesn't take calls, and no one there even knows a number for the main office anyway. UTTER bull & I see now that they have a Better Business Bureau rating of "F".

Dear consumer, I deeply apologize for the misunderstanding. Please contact DPI and ask to speak to Cust Srv Mgr so that we can rectify this issue. We do offer plans for Critical Care customers, possibly the plan the agent selected was incorrect. I would like a chance to change this experience for you. If not needing service, please reply simply with your account number so I can expedite your refund.
